Directions

  1. Dissolve yeast in 1/4 cup lukewarm water. If you plan to bake immediately, other 1 1/4 cup water should also be warm. If you plan to store dough in refrigerator for later use, dissolve yeast in 1/4 cup lukewarm water, and use cold water for other 1 1/4 cup.Sift together flour and sugar. Cut in solid shortening (use a pastry cutter, it's easier) or possibly salad oil. Add in yeast water.
  2. Since this recipe gives you a dough that is rather sticky, just mix the ingredients using a sturdy spoon (a wooden one is fine), till everything is well blended. Then keep stirring till the dough forms elastic-like strands when you pull the spoon from the bowl.
  3. Place the dough into a greased bowl and cover. Now, if you want to serve hot rolls tonight, let your dough rise for 30 min. If you want to bake them later in the week, cover the bowl well and put the dough into the refrigerator immediately.
  4. To prepare rolls for the oven, place the dough on a well-floured dough board or possibly other flat surface. Now, you do not have to knead this dough, just smooth it gently using your hands. Then roll with a rolling pin. Cut and shape the rolls, and place them in a greased pan. Cover with warm damp cloth and allow to rise for 45 min.
  5. It also helps to brush melted butter or possibly shortening over them before or possibly after they rise. Bake for about 15 min at 450 degrees.
